Save the Strays Animal Rescue

Save the Strays has been rescuing abandoned and unwanted dogs since 2003. Our goal is to find them new homes where they will be treated as cherished family members. Dogs that aren’t adoptable remain with us for as long as they live. We are an all-volunteer, no-kill rescue incorporated as a not-for-profit, 501(c)(3) tax-exempt organization and public charity. All donations to our rescue are tax-deductible and are used solely to pay for our dogs’ care.

Meet Delilah

DELIGHTFUL DELILAH needs a new home before the end of August. Her adopter is moving into a senior apartment that doesn’t allow dogs of her size (78 lbs) so now, at age 11, she needs to find a new human to love. Because she was originally adopted from Save the Strays Animal Rescue, we are fielding inquiries for Delilah’s owner. Delilah had an annual veterinary exam in March which included a 4DX test (detects heartworms and 3 tick-borne diseases - all negative!) and a Proheart injection which provides heartworm prevention for 12 months. Her rabies and DAPP vaccines and flea/tick prevention are all up to date. Delilah enjoys morning walks and sleeping in bed with her human (if allowed). She’s affectionate and good with other dogs. Adoption Process
Potential adopters must complete an application, provide references and be interviewed. If approved, they must sign an adoption contract and pay an adoption fee, which is refundable if a dog is returned to us within two weeks of the adoption date.
